Origins and Processing Methods of Beet Sugar and Cane Sugar
Beet sugar and cane sugar, 2 predominant sweeteners, stem from really unique plants and undertake different processing approaches. Beet sugar is drawn out from the sugar beet, an origin vegetable, largely expanded in cooler environments. The handling includes slicing the beets to draw out the juice, which is then purified and crystallized into sugar. This approach is reasonably reliable, permitting sugar recuperation from several stages of the process.
On the other hand, cane sugar comes from the sugarcane plant, an exotic lawn. Its processing starts with collecting the cane, crushing it to obtain the juice, and after that steaming this liquid to form sugar crystals. The continuing to be molasses-rich liquid can be re-boiled several times to produce differing grades of sugar. This process, although rather similar in its objective, differs considerably in regards to the ecological conditions needed for cultivation and the first actions in extracting sugar. beet sugar vs cane sugar. Each approach shows adjustments to the particular plant's natural environments and buildings.
Nutritional Comparison: Beet Sugar Versus Cane Sugar

When contrasting the dietary content of beet sugar and cane sugar, it becomes obvious that both kinds give a comparable energy value. Both beet and cane sugar are 99.9% pure sucrose, making them practically similar in terms of calorie web content and dietary account.
Nonetheless, slight differences may occur from the very little trace aspects that continue to be after handling, though these are also small to influence total health. For example, cane sugar can retain traces of molasses, depending upon the degree of refining, which may add small amounts of calcium, iron, and potassium. Beet sugar, on the various other hand, typically undergoes a procedure that removes these micronutrient better, causing an also purer type of sucrose.
Culinary Utilizes and Flavor Profiles
Despite their nutritional resemblances, beet sugar and cane sugar deviate significantly in their culinary applications and flavor subtleties. Beet sugar, originated from sugar beetroots, normally has an extremely neutral taste, making it a preferred selection in cooking where it perfectly integrates without altering the taste profile of other active ingredients. beet sugar vs cane sugar. It liquifies quickly, which is beneficial in drinks and great desserts. On the other hand, cane sugar, sourced from the sugarcane plant, typically lugs refined hints of molasses, also in its refined form. This can include a warm, caramel-like undertone to recipes, improving recipes like cookies, cakes, and sauces where a richer taste is desirable.
Cooks and home cooks alike pick sugars based on these characteristics. Health Effects of Consuming Beet and Cane Sugars
Although beet sugar and cane sugar are frequently made use of interchangeably in cooking and cooking, their health ramifications can vary discreetly because of their unique handling methods. Both sugars supply concerning the same amount of calories and carbs per tsp, basically offering similar power go to my blog payments with no intrinsic nutritional advantages. Nonetheless, the refining procedure for each sugar can change the existence of trace element and substances, although these variants are generally very little and not considerable adequate to influence one's wellness meaningfully.
The key health interest in both types of sugar pertains to their contribution to excessive calorie intake, potentially leading to weight gain, and associated diseases like type 2 diabetes and heart disease when eaten in huge quantities. Regardless of the source, small amounts is vital in taking in beet or cane sugars.
